NO42NE 53 468 261

A collection of 3 stone pebbles, 5 ochre lumps (haematite), 6 struck flint cores, 67 flaked spalls and 37 waste flakes of flint, chalcedony, and other stone materials, 58 struck flint flakes with some microliths, and a barbed-and-tanged flint arrowhead (Acc Nos 1983-305 to 1983-312). Macehead: A pin-cushion type macehead (greywacke) with hour-glass perforation (Acc No 1983-304). All were surface collections from the area of the mesolithic camp site, (NO42NE 9). Acquired by Dundee Museum.

A Zealand 1988.
